Output 57bab58125fdb5f1feaf9412b580710582a00e6e614474d9e9628d351161d41c:1

value
1610403000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f2a3a1edefecc9ee5d77f91cc31e3a6c376184 OP_EQUAL
address
36t8S9oxVPE6cyUJCtZ9dafwwF4xAEyGrN
transaction
57bab58125fdb5f1feaf9412b580710582a00e6e614474d9e9628d351161d41c
confirmations
386056
spent
true